By using this site, you agree to our Privacy Policy and our Terms of Use. Close

That's an... interesting name. The game looks atmospheric but at the same time, its gameplay looks like what you'd see in a typical zombie shooter, which kind of doesn't fit the atmosphere. Probably not my cup of tea but seems pretty decent.